Home Health Agency looking to hire full time Patient Services Specialist/Scheduler
DUTIES OF POSITION:
Is responsible for the coordination of patient visits, maintenance and upkeep of scheduling.
Staffing coordination duties include the accurate and timely communication of scheduling changes between, patient, office and field staff.
POSITION RESPONSIBILITIES:
Maintain a current patient roster with necessary information.
Update schedules regularly.
Prepare weekly schedule for field staff and provides copies for distribution.
Assist in coordinating services provided to patients.
Control and monitor schedule changes.
Check compliance of visits done (on master schedule) after all notes are matched to charges, brings any scheduling problems to the supervisors' attention immediately.
Assist in taking referrals, makes copies of referral sheets for Payroll / Billing Manager and on-call coordinator when requested.
Obtain weekly visit count and report results to the Nursing Supervisor and Chief Clinical Officer.
Assist in relaying messages to the field staff, patients, office staff and community liaisons.
Perform other duties as assigned by the Nursing Supervisor or Chief Clinical Officer.
